Dear Heloise: I have been fighting with the pad on my ironing board forever, it seems. I no sooner smooth it back in place than it slides to one side or creeps back from the narrow end, leaving bare edges. Finally, out of patience, I put a strip of double-sided tape, the kind used to hold rugs to the floor, lengthwise on the bare board, carefully positioned the pad onto the tape and replaced the cover. No more shifting of the pad and after two months, everything is holding. - E.J. Catron, Colorado Springs, Colo.

Dear Heloise: Next time you empty out a chili-seasoning can, instead of throwing it out, refill it with salt and take it to work for your desk drawer.

If there are a few sprinkles of chili powder in it, it won’t hurt a thing. - Ilena Holder, Hollywood, Ala.
